                  • JaredBuschJ
                    JaredBusch @JaredBusch
                    last edited by

                    @scottalanmiller said:

                    Google suggests that you use this name: smtp-relay.gmail.com

                    @JaredBusch said:

                    That is specific to Google Apps. I thought he was using a personal Gmail account. That would be smtp.gmail.com
